Output 39a6ee33eb06cca99eae23ab2201dca11544cf80a7dc60c5ae797701147153b8:112

value
73393
script pubkey
OP_0 OP_PUSHBYTES_20 680fa73883d49a22a28ab63723ca7bdd70cbdd47
address
bc1qdq86wwyr6jdz9g52kcmj8jnmm4cvhh28y0ettz
transaction
39a6ee33eb06cca99eae23ab2201dca11544cf80a7dc60c5ae797701147153b8
confirmations
115560
spent
true